Aluminum platform hand trucks are essential tools in various industries, providing a lightweight yet sturdy solution for transporting goods. Their design allows for easy maneuverability and efficient handling, making them a popular choice in warehouses, retail environments, and even at home. However, to ensure optimal handling and safety, it is crucial to understand the best practices associated with their use. This article will explore the dos and don'ts of using aluminum platform hand trucks, providing insights into their maintenance, safety measures, and operational efficiency.

Aluminum platform hand trucks are wheeled carts made primarily from aluminum, designed to carry heavy loads. They typically feature a flat platform, which can be used to transport boxes, equipment, and other items. The lightweight nature of aluminum makes these hand trucks easy to maneuver, while their robust construction ensures they can handle significant weight.
1. Lightweight and Portable: Aluminum is much lighter than steel, making these hand trucks easy to lift and transport.
2. Durability: Aluminum is resistant to rust and corrosion, ensuring longevity even in harsh environments.
3. Cost-Effective: While the initial investment may be higher than plastic or wooden alternatives, the durability of aluminum hand trucks often leads to lower long-term costs.
4. Versatility: Suitable for various applications, from industrial settings to home use.
Selecting the appropriate aluminum platform hand truck is crucial. Consider the following factors:
- Load Capacity: Ensure the hand truck can handle the weight of the items you intend to transport. Check the manufacturer's specifications for maximum load limits.
- Platform Size: Choose a platform size that accommodates your typical load. A larger platform may be necessary for bulkier items, while a smaller one may suffice for standard boxes.
- Wheel Type: Different wheel types are suited for various surfaces. Hard wheels are ideal for smooth floors, while softer wheels are better for uneven surfaces.
Regular inspections are vital for maintaining safety and efficiency. Check for:
- Structural Integrity: Look for any signs of damage, such as bent frames or cracked wheels.
- Wheel Condition: Ensure wheels are not worn down and rotate freely. Replace any damaged wheels immediately.
- Fasteners and Joints: Tighten any loose screws or bolts to prevent accidents during use.
When loading and unloading items, use proper lifting techniques to avoid injury:
- Bend at the Knees: Always bend your knees and keep your back straight when lifting heavy items.
- Keep the Load Close: Hold the load close to your body to maintain balance and reduce strain.
- Use Your Legs: Lift with your legs, not your back, to minimize the risk of injury.
Before moving the hand truck, ensure the path is clear of obstacles. This includes:
- Removing Debris: Clear away any items that could cause tripping or falling.
- Checking Doorways and Aisles: Ensure that doorways and aisles are wide enough for the hand truck to pass through without obstruction.
If you are using aluminum platform hand trucks in a workplace setting, ensure that all employees are trained on their proper use. Training should cover:
- Operational Procedures: How to load and unload items safely.
- Emergency Protocols: What to do in case of an accident or equipment failure.
- Maintenance Practices: How to inspect and maintain the hand truck.
One of the most critical safety measures is to never exceed the hand truck's load limit. Overloading can lead to:
- Equipment Failure: Excess weight can cause structural damage to the hand truck.
- Injury: Overloaded hand trucks are harder to control, increasing the risk of accidents.
While aluminum platform hand trucks are versatile, they are not designed for all surfaces. Avoid using them on:
- Uneven Terrain: This can lead to tipping and loss of control.
- Stairs: Hand trucks should not be used on stairs unless specifically designed for that purpose.
Always keep an eye on the hand truck when it is in use. Leaving it unattended can lead to:
- Accidents: Someone may trip over it or it may roll away.
- Theft or Damage: Unattended equipment is more susceptible to theft or vandalism.
Neglecting maintenance can lead to serious issues. Avoid:
- Skipping Inspections: Regular checks are essential for safety.
- Ignoring Repairs: Address any issues immediately to prevent further damage or accidents.
Using the hand truck for items it is not designed to carry can lead to accidents. Avoid:
- Carrying People: Hand trucks are not designed for transporting individuals.
- Transporting Hazardous Materials: Unless specifically designed for such use, avoid carrying hazardous materials that could spill or cause injury.
To ensure the longevity and safety of your aluminum platform hand truck, follow these maintenance tips:
- Clean Regularly: Keep the hand truck clean to prevent corrosion and maintain its appearance.
- Lubricate Moving Parts: Regularly lubricate wheels and joints to ensure smooth operation.
- Store Properly: When not in use, store the hand truck in a dry area to prevent rust and damage.
When using aluminum platform hand trucks, consider wearing safety gear to protect yourself:
- Steel-Toed Boots: Protect your feet from heavy items that may fall.
- Gloves: Use gloves to improve grip and protect your hands from sharp edges.
- High-Visibility Clothing: Wear bright clothing to ensure you are seen, especially in busy environments.

1. What is the maximum load capacity for aluminum platform hand trucks?
- The maximum load capacity varies by model, but most can handle between 500 to 1,500 pounds. Always check the manufacturer's specifications.
2. Can I use an aluminum platform hand truck on stairs?
- Generally, aluminum platform hand trucks are not designed for use on stairs. Use specialized stair-climbing hand trucks for that purpose.
3. How often should I inspect my hand truck?
- It is recommended to inspect your hand truck before each use to ensure it is in good working condition.
4. What should I do if my hand truck is damaged?
- If you notice any damage, do not use the hand truck. Repair or replace it as necessary to ensure safety.
5. Is training necessary for using hand trucks in the workplace?
- Yes, training is essential to ensure all employees understand how to use hand trucks safely and effectively.
